President Trump to meet with Ukrainian President Zelenskyy as U.S.-Russia tensions rise

(CNN, KYMA) -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ky says he's meeting with U.S. President Donald Trump this week as U.S.-Russian tensions rise.

He says they'll talk on the sidelines of the U.N. General Assembly in New York.

Their meeting comes as President Trump says he will defend the Baltic states and Poland from Russia if necessary. That's after Russian incursions into NATO airspace.

Those include flying jets over Estonian territory Friday and drones over Polish and Romanian land earlier this month.

Article V of the NATO Treaty says an attack on one member state is an attack on all of them.

It requires alerting the U.S. Security Council and that group is holding an emergency meeting Monday at Estonia's request.
